If you're looking at taking whey protein i'd stick to the stuff at your local GNC or health food center. Usually companies pack a lot of extra's into their whey products that you wouldn't get from whole foods or straight whey protein (which I imagine taste like a$$) GNC brand is pretty good and cheap. If you have a high budget Optimal Nutrition makes a good brand with added Glutamine which helps with muscle repair. Just about any brand of whey you buy will be similar, it all depends on how much you like the taste. Though it has to be better than eating the Little Miss Muffett stuff you're trying to swallow down and at least you know exactly what you're getting.

I am into week two of new training.
I am following the program being used by webmaster at this time. I have done many programs in the last 40 years of weight training. At present I am only concerned with strength and size. I am following exactly the five set five rep with 5 min between each! (the max) each.

This is also found at GNC (I got 10lbs.)
I am also eating 4-5 times a day. I also am drinking vast amounts of water. Add to this 3 8oz shakes made in milk with NITRO - TECH HARDCORE made by Muscletech. For 30 days drinking 3 shakes a day (approx 70grms protein each) plus well, read about the stuff it's awsome. After that 30 days I am cutting down to two a day. I am also taking so ther powerful growth stimulators and suppliments.**** NOTE: *** I can not stress water intake enough.***
